Ingredients

- 3 oz (90 ml) silver tequila
- 1 oz (30 ml) orange liqueur (such as Cointreau or triple sec)
- 4 oz (120 ml) fresh guava nectar (strained if pulpy)
- 1 oz (30 ml) freshly squeezed lime juice
- 1/2 oz (15 ml) agave syrup (adjust to taste)
- 2 lime wedges, for garnish
- Coarse salt or Tajín, for rimming glasses
- Ice cubes
Instructions
- Step 1
- Run a lime wedge around the rims of two rocks or margarita glasses. Dip the rims into coarse salt or Tajín to coat.
- Step 2
- Fill a cocktail shaker with ice. Add tequila, orange liqueur, guava nectar, lime juice, and agave syrup.
- Step 3
- Shake vigorously for 20 seconds until well chilled.
- Step 4
- Fill the prepared glasses with fresh ice. Strain the margarita mixture evenly into each glass.
- Step 5
- Garnish with a lime wedge and, if desired, a thin slice of fresh guava.

For a frozen version of this drink, blend all ingredients with 1 cup of ice until smooth. If you prefer a spicy kick, muddle a thin slice of jalapeño in the shaker before adding the liquid ingredients.

Substitute guava nectar with mango or passion fruit nectar for a different tropical variation of this cocktail. You can also adjust the amount of agave syrup to reach your preferred level of sweetness.

Recipe FAQs
- → What type of tequila works best?
Silver or blanco tequila is ideal for guava margaritas because its clean, crisp flavor lets the tropical guava notes shine without overpowering them.
- → Can I make this ahead of time?
Mix the tequila, orange liqueur, guava nectar, lime juice, and agave syrup in a pitcher up to 4 hours before serving. Shake with ice just before pouring into rimmed glasses.
- → How do I strain guava nectar?
Pass the nectar through a fine-mesh sieve to remove pulp for a smoother texture. For a thicker mouthfeel, leave some pulp intact.
- → What's the difference between salt and Tajín?
Coarse salt provides classic savory contrast to the sweet guava. Tajín combines salt with chili powder and lime for a spicy, tangy kick that pairs beautifully with tropical flavors.
- → Can I use frozen guava pulp?
Thaw frozen guava pulp and blend with water to reach nectar consistency. Strain if desired, then use as a fresh substitute.
- → How do I make a frozen version?
Combine all ingredients with 1 cup of ice in a blender and process until smooth. Pour into prepared glasses without straining.
